    Actually this is a legitimate number from Capital One.  They have multiple numbers they call from.  You can always request that you do not receive phone calls and all contact has to come through writing.  You will have to send a letter to them certified return receipt though.  After the letter is received they legally are not allowed to contact you via the phone.

    replies replies to BSF
    You goofed up when you told them your her sister.
    They will never stop calling you.
    Change your number and they will even call your neighbors, harassing them to get your new number.

    Get their address and send them a  CEASE AND DESIST LETTER
    Telling them to stop contacting you in any way !
    Stop calling your home number, work, or sending letters. That the person they are looking for does not
    and never has lives at your address or has never used your phone number and does not have permission
    to use your phone number.

    Always keep a copy of your letter, sending the cease and desist letter by u.s. mail, certified with return receipt requested.
    keeping all post office receipts, the green return receipt post card you get back by return mail, etc.
    staple all that to your cease and desist letter for future action.
    If they continue to call you, see an attorney to sue them
    Make sure in your cease and desist letter that you put the numbers they are calling you on. The numbers to stop calling.
    Make sure your add that the number your listing for them to stop calling . tell them any other numbers they may have now or obtain in the future to NOT call.

    SO NEVER PAY OVER THE PHONE, NEVER ADMIT TO ANYTHING TO A VOICE OVER THE PHONE ( UNLESS YOU CALLED THEM AND KNOW WHO  AND WHAT YOUR TALKING TO )

    TELL THEM TO PUT WHAT EVER THEY HAVE TO SAY IN WRITING AND SEND YOU A LETTER.
    TELL THEM TO PUT IN THE LETTER THE__  

    NAME OF THE ORIGINAL CREDITOR
    CURRENT OWNER OF THE DEBT IS DIFFERENT FROM ORIGINAL CREDITOR
    AND IF CURENT OWNER IS DIFFERENT FROM ORIGINAL CREDITOR FOR THEM TO
    INCLUDE THEIR PROOF, BILL OF SALE, DOCUMENT'S WTC. WHERE THEY PURCHASED YOUR DEBT
    DATE THEY PURCHSED THE DEBT
    DATE OF LAST PAYMENT TOWARD SAID ALLEGED DEBT
    THEIR COLLECTION AGENCY LICENSE NUMBER TO COLLECT DEBTS IN YOUR STATE
    THEIR PHYSICAL STREET ADDRESS, NOT A P.O. BOX-- NOT A P.O.BOX
    TELL THEM YOU WILL NOT SEND PAYMENT TO A    P.O. BOX , THAT IS HAS TO BE TO A PHYSICAL
    STREET ADDRESS.
    AND ANYTHING ELSE YOU MIGHT THINK OF FOR THEM TO PROVE YOU OWE ALLEGED DEBT
    AND THAT THEY OWN OR HAVE A  "" LEGAL "" RIGHT TO COLLECT SAID DEBT.

    THE ABOVE IS USUALLY REFERRED TO  " DEBT VALIDATION " WHICH IS YOUR RIGHT UNDER FEDERAL FAIR
    DEBT COLLECTION PRACTICES AVT.

    IF YOUR NOT CAREFUL TO MAKE SURE WHO YOUR PAYING. YOU  LIKELY WILL BE PAYING SOMEONE WHO IS
    NOT ENTITLED TO BE PAID. WHO IS NOT THE OWNER OF YOUR ALLEGED DEBT.
    IF YOU DO OR HAVE DONE THAT, YOU STILL OWN THE LEGITIMATE OWNER OF THAT DEBT AND WILL HAVE TO PAY IT.
    SENDING PAYMENT TO A P.O. BOX OR OTHER BOX IS BAD AND THAT WHY YOU SHOULD NOT.
    THEY CAN RENT ONE, DO THEIR SCAM OR WHATEVER THEN CLOSE IT AND MOVE ON.
    AT LEAST WITH A PHYSICAL ADDRESS, STREET ADDRESS YOU WOULD HAVE MORE INFORMATION TO GO
    ON IF YOU ARE SCAMMED. LAWYERS, GOVERNMENT WILL HAVE MORE INFO ON WHO OWNE, RENTED THE
    PHYSICAL STREET ADDRESS YOU SENT THE PAYMENT TO.

    BEFORE YOU EVER PAY A DEBT, VALIDATE IT.
    MAKE SURE IT IS NOT PAST THE STATUTE LIMITATIONS.
    COLLECTION AGENCIES BUY AND SELL DEBT ALL THE TIME.
    ONE DAY, WHO YOU OWE MIGHT BE ONE PERSON/COMPANY
    THE NEXT IT MIGHT BE ANOTHER.
    YOU SHOULD NEVER PAY WITHOUT KNOWING WHO YOUR PAYING AND IF THEY ARE LEGALLY ENTITLED
    TO BE PAID.
